Hans College of Education, Jaipur, is indeed a significant institute with a commendable antecedence, which is said to strive towards the innovation of future educators and the upliftment of education as it exists. The scope of education, co-educational, affiliated with the National Council for Teacher Education (NCTE) for special courses on education, is located in Kotputli, in the district of Jaipur, Rajasthan.
Admissions procedures at Hans College of Education seek to find strong motivation steered and capable students into various programs of the college. The admission works through merit-based systems, thereby granting admission by considering the marks of both the qualifying examination and/or the entrance exams. To some programs, the admission process needs to follow the policy of the state establishment and the relevant university.
Eligibility differs from one program to another. B. Ed candidates should have a bachelor's degree or equivalent from any recognizable university. Integrated programs such as BA B. Ed and B.Sc B.Ed require students who will complete 10+2 with relevant subjects for eligibility.
Application Process
The usual application process for Hans College of Education, Jaipur, is as follows:
1. Announcement of Admissions: The admissions process is only announced by the college through its website or through certain media.
2. Application Form: Candidates have to obtain and fill in the application form, either online on the college website or through the college admission office.

4. Application Fee: The candidate must pay the prescribed application fee. The mode of payment and fee amount will be specified in application instructions.
5. Entrance Exam/Merit List: Based on the program and the present admission policy, the candidate may require to take an entrance exam or be chosen in a merit list made according to their qualifying examination scores.
6. Counseling and Document Verification: Candidates will be notified regarding a counseling session during which their original documents will be verified.
7. Fee Payment: Selected candidates will pay the course fee within the mentioned time to confirm admission.
8. Enrollment: After completing all the above steps, candidates are officially enrolled in their course of choice at Hans College of Education.
Degree wise Admission Process
B.Ed: The B.Ed course in the Hans College of Education has an approved intake of 200 students. Merit-based admission to this two-year course is based on the qualifying examination marks and/or entrance examination. The selection process is as per state government and affiliated university policies.
BA B.Ed: This is a four-year integrated program offered by the college. While specific admission details are not provided, it is likely that the admission process involves consideration of 10+2 marks and possibly an entrance exam or interview.
B.Sc B.Ed: Just like the BA B.Ed program, it also represents a four-year integrated course. Admission most probably considers the performance in 10+2 with science subjects and other additional specifications by the college or affiliated university.
